Well it's been a crazy week of bodywork and fighting the car... After media blasting the front fenders Sunday we found that they were trash... Between the driver's side being hit in the past and the warps put in before us I had to find replacements. Got lucky and within 8 hours of getting the word out we secured a set of NOS 71 fenders in Illinois! So that makes things a little easier...

Shop employees have doubled in the last couple of days! We have now gone from 3 to 7!! A few body guys from the local shops have stepped up to help out! Josh is my body and paint guy. You will never here me say I can do bodywork. I can fabricate, weld, and do anything else, but bodywork hates me and I hate it! LOL I just had to get some help for Josh, now we won't be two weeks out on paint but sometime in the next week!

This is my first SEMA car so I'm making it perfect! WE have been so anal about every little defect and detail on the body... It's taking time, but its time well spent!!

All the brake lines and fuel lines are installed as well as the new tank and RobbMc sending unit. Ready to drop the motor and tranny in on Thursday when the 440 gets here!!
